Generated from protobuf message google.cloud.dialogflow.v2.SuggestConversationSummaryRequest
Namespace
Google \ Cloud \ Dialogflow \ V2
Methods
__construct
Constructor.
Parameters
Name
Description
data
array
Optional. Data for populating the Message object.
↳ conversation
string
Required. The conversation to fetch suggestion for. Format: projects/<Project ID>/locations/<Location ID>/conversations/<Conversation ID>.
↳ latest_message
string
Optional. The name of the latest conversation message used as context for compiling suggestion. If empty, the latest message of the conversation will be used. Format: projects/<Project ID>/locations/<Location ID>/conversations/<Conversation ID>/messages/<Message ID>.
↳ context_size
int
Optional. Max number of messages prior to and including [latest_message] to use as context when compiling the suggestion. By default 500 and at most 1000.
Optional. The name of the latest conversation message used as context for
compiling suggestion. If empty, the latest message of the conversation will
be used.
Optional. The name of the latest conversation message used as context for
compiling suggestion. If empty, the latest message of the conversation will
be used.
Optional. Max number of messages prior to and including
[latest_message] to use as context when compiling the
suggestion. By default 500 and at most 1000.
Returns
Type
Description
int
setContextSize
Optional. Max number of messages prior to and including
[latest_message] to use as context when compiling the
suggestion. By default 500 and at most 1000.
Parameter
Name
Description
var
int
Returns
Type
Description
$this
getAssistQueryParams
Optional. Parameters for a human assist query. Only used for POC/demo
purpose.
Required. The conversation to fetch suggestion for.
Format: projects/<Project ID>/locations/<Location
ID>/conversations/<Conversation ID>. Please see
ConversationsClient::conversationName() for help formatting this field.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Hard to understand","hardToUnderstand","thumb-down"],["Incorrect information or sample code","incorrectInformationOrSampleCode","thumb-down"],["Missing the information/samples I need","missingTheInformationSamplesINeed","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-09-04 UTC."],[],[],null,["# Google Cloud Dialogflow V2 Client - Class SuggestConversationSummaryRequest (2.1.2)\n\nVersion latestkeyboard_arrow_down\n\n- [2.1.2 (latest)](/php/docs/reference/cloud-dialogflow/latest/V2.SuggestConversationSummaryRequest)\n- [2.1.1](/php/docs/reference/cloud-dialogflow/2.1.1/V2.SuggestConversationSummaryRequest)\n- [2.0.1](/php/docs/reference/cloud-dialogflow/2.0.1/V2.SuggestConversationSummaryRequest)\n- [1.17.2](/php/docs/reference/cloud-dialogflow/1.17.2/V2.SuggestConversationSummaryRequest)\n- [1.16.0](/php/docs/reference/cloud-dialogflow/1.16.0/V2.SuggestConversationSummaryRequest)\n- [1.15.1](/php/docs/reference/cloud-dialogflow/1.15.1/V2.SuggestConversationSummaryRequest)\n- [1.14.0](/php/docs/reference/cloud-dialogflow/1.14.0/V2.SuggestConversationSummaryRequest)\n- [1.13.0](/php/docs/reference/cloud-dialogflow/1.13.0/V2.SuggestConversationSummaryRequest)\n- [1.12.3](/php/docs/reference/cloud-dialogflow/1.12.3/V2.SuggestConversationSummaryRequest)\n- [1.11.0](/php/docs/reference/cloud-dialogflow/1.11.0/V2.SuggestConversationSummaryRequest)\n- [1.10.2](/php/docs/reference/cloud-dialogflow/1.10.2/V2.SuggestConversationSummaryRequest)\n- [1.9.0](/php/docs/reference/cloud-dialogflow/1.9.0/V2.SuggestConversationSummaryRequest)\n- [1.8.0](/php/docs/reference/cloud-dialogflow/1.8.0/V2.SuggestConversationSummaryRequest)\n- [1.7.2](/php/docs/reference/cloud-dialogflow/1.7.2/V2.SuggestConversationSummaryRequest)\n- [1.6.0](/php/docs/reference/cloud-dialogflow/1.6.0/V2.SuggestConversationSummaryRequest)\n- [1.5.0](/php/docs/reference/cloud-dialogflow/1.5.0/V2.SuggestConversationSummaryRequest)\n- [1.4.0](/php/docs/reference/cloud-dialogflow/1.4.0/V2.SuggestConversationSummaryRequest)\n- [1.3.2](/php/docs/reference/cloud-dialogflow/1.3.2/V2.SuggestConversationSummaryRequest)\n- [1.2.0](/php/docs/reference/cloud-dialogflow/1.2.0/V2.SuggestConversationSummaryRequest)\n- [1.1.1](/php/docs/reference/cloud-dialogflow/1.1.1/V2.SuggestConversationSummaryRequest)\n- [1.0.1](/php/docs/reference/cloud-dialogflow/1.0.1/V2.SuggestConversationSummaryRequest) \nReference documentation and code samples for the Google Cloud Dialogflow V2 Client class SuggestConversationSummaryRequest.\n\nThe request message for\n[Conversations.SuggestConversationSummary](/php/docs/reference/cloud-dialogflow/latest/V2.Client.ConversationsClient#_Google_Cloud_Dialogflow_V2_Client_ConversationsClient__suggestConversationSummary__).\n\nGenerated from protobuf message `google.cloud.dialogflow.v2.SuggestConversationSummaryRequest`\n\nNamespace\n---------\n\nGoogle \\\\ Cloud \\\\ Dialogflow \\\\ V2\n\nMethods\n-------\n\n### __construct\n\nConstructor.\n\n### getConversation\n\nRequired. The conversation to fetch suggestion for.\n\nFormat: `projects/\u003cProject ID\u003e/locations/\u003cLocation\nID\u003e/conversations/\u003cConversation ID\u003e`.\n\n### setConversation\n\nRequired. The conversation to fetch suggestion for.\n\nFormat: `projects/\u003cProject ID\u003e/locations/\u003cLocation\nID\u003e/conversations/\u003cConversation ID\u003e`.\n\n### getLatestMessage\n\nOptional. The name of the latest conversation message used as context for\ncompiling suggestion. If empty, the latest message of the conversation will\nbe used.\n\nFormat: `projects/\u003cProject ID\u003e/locations/\u003cLocation\nID\u003e/conversations/\u003cConversation ID\u003e/messages/\u003cMessage ID\u003e`.\n\n### setLatestMessage\n\nOptional. The name of the latest conversation message used as context for\ncompiling suggestion. If empty, the latest message of the conversation will\nbe used.\n\nFormat: `projects/\u003cProject ID\u003e/locations/\u003cLocation\nID\u003e/conversations/\u003cConversation ID\u003e/messages/\u003cMessage ID\u003e`.\n\n### getContextSize\n\nOptional. Max number of messages prior to and including\n\\[latest_message\\] to use as context when compiling the\nsuggestion. By default 500 and at most 1000.\n\n### setContextSize\n\nOptional. Max number of messages prior to and including\n\\[latest_message\\] to use as context when compiling the\nsuggestion. By default 500 and at most 1000.\n\n### getAssistQueryParams\n\nOptional. Parameters for a human assist query. Only used for POC/demo\npurpose.\n\n### hasAssistQueryParams\n\n### clearAssistQueryParams\n\n### setAssistQueryParams\n\nOptional. Parameters for a human assist query. Only used for POC/demo\npurpose.\n\n### static::build"]]